My transmission shifts ok from 1st to second but then almost immediately into third. This is only at part throttle. WOT shifts are fine. I have been putting up with this for a while. Lately I have spending more time on the street than at the track so it's getting annoying.

I have readjusted the TV cable and tried a couple clicks tighter, but that didn't seem to help.

Any suggestions?

we need pressure readings and wot shift points in engine rpm.do you get a 2/1 kickdown in manual second @15 mph at wot?
 
Finally found some time to spend on the car.

WOT Shift point: 4900-5000
Downshift from 15 MPH in second yes, but not at 18 MPH
Pressures:
Min TV- P/N 85, Rev.135, D/OD 85, 1st/2nd 250
Max TV- P/N 230, Rev.300, D/OD 230, 1st/2nd 250

Thes pressures were with engine at operating temps but trans just warm to touch. The trans seems to shift the same cold or hot though.

Did you change any springs in the VB?
Like the MTV upshift spring, a GN VB doesn't have one. If you did that could be the problem.
 
It sounds as if you have the same problem I had after my rebuild. The mechanic called it a "stacked shift". He said it was caused by something in the valve body. He tried cleaning the valves out and it helped alot but the stacked shift would still come back every so often. He put in a new valve body and all was well....almost. If you try replacing your valve body make sure to use a GN body. He used a non-performance valve body in mine and the shifts are alot softer, even with a shift kit and 200 servo.
 
The only valve body springs I changed were the accumulator valve assembly spring, the line bias valve spring and the 1-2 accumulator spring.

I don't know about the TV modulator upshift spring. It is a gn valve body though.

Stacked shift sounds like the proper term. Maybe it is just dirt or lint in the valve body somewhere.
